优化FineReport报表设计的技巧
在现代数据分析中,良好的报表设计至关重要,尤其是在FineReport报表软件中。通过合理配置页面设计,可以实现数据的无缝纵向延伸,从而避免在多页展示时出现空隙和浪费。本文将介绍如何利用“自动换行”功能进行优化,确保信息布局既美观又高效。
步骤一:数据准备
首先,我们需要新建一个模板,并创建数据集ds1。在SQL查询中,使用以下代码获取数据:
SELECT * FROM 公司股票
步骤二:模板设计
接下来,进入报表的主体设计环节,根据需求设计报表样式。确保每一个设计细节都能提升数据的可读性,以下是设计示例:
步骤三:未分栏预览
在保存报表后,预览模板以查看当前的展示效果。如图所示,您将会发现每页数据仅能显示9列,而页面下方却留有大量空白,这样的空间浪费是不可取的。
步骤四:分栏设置
针对上述问题,可以进行分栏设置。根据预览结果,每页能显示的9列数据中,去掉标题列后,仅剩8列可用。因此,我们可以设置每一栏最多显示8列,超出的部分将会转移至下一栏。
具体操作步骤如下:在菜单栏中选择“模板”后点击“报表分栏”,将设置调整为列分栏,并规定当列数超过8时进行分栏。参与分栏的数据范围为B2到B8,如下图所示:
总结
通过以上步骤的优化设置,不仅能提高FineReport的报表视觉效果,还能有效利用空间,增强数据的展示效果。希望本文能够帮助您在使用FineReport时,获得更好的报表设计体验。